Link building is a crucial aspect of search engine optimization (SEO) that involves acquiring hyperlinks from other websites to your own. These links act as signals to search engines that your site is reputable and authoritative, ultimately improving your site’s ranking in search results. While there are various strategies for link building, one way link building is a popular and effective method that involves getting backlinks to your site without having to reciprocate by linking back to the source. In this article, we will delve into the benefits of one way link building and how you can implement this strategy for your website.
One way link building is advantageous because it helps build your site’s credibility and authority in the eyes of search engines. When other websites link to your content without expecting a link back, it sends a signal to search engines that your content is valuable and worthy of reference. This can lead to higher search engine rankings, increased organic traffic, and ultimately, more visibility and exposure for your website. Additionally, one way links are often seen as more authentic and natural compared to reciprocal links, which can further boost your site’s reputation in the online space.
There are several ways to acquire one way links for your website. One common method is to create high-quality, relevant content that naturally attracts links from other websites. By producing valuable and engaging content that addresses the needs and interests of your target audience, you increase the likelihood of other websites referencing and linking to your content. Additionally, you can reach out to influencers, bloggers, and industry-related websites to request backlinks to your site. Building relationships with key players in your industry can help you secure one way links from reputable and authoritative sources.
Another effective strategy for one way link building is to leverage social media platforms and online communities to promote your content and attract backlinks. By sharing your content on plat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n, you can reach a wider audience and increase the chances of your content being shared and linked to by others. Engaging with online communities and participating in discussions related to your industry can also help you establish connections and earn one way links from relevant sources. Remember to focus on quality over quantity when it comes to one way link building, as links from authoritative and relevant websites carry more weight in the eyes of search engines.
